Ramarajupalli Village ( రామరాజుపల్లి ) , Pamidi , Ananthapuramu District
Ramarajupalli village is located in Pamidi Mandal of Ananthapuramu district in Andhra Pradesh. This village is covered by Pincode 515775 . Ramarajupalli is having total population of 165. It falls under Guntakal Assembly constituency and Anantapur Parliamentary constituency.

About Ramarajupalli
Ramarajupalli village was formed by merging the following villages:
- Akkajampalle
- Ramarajupalle
Population Details of Ramarajupalli
Population details of Ramarajupalli are based on 2011 Census . Data provided below may have discrepancies if the villages have gone through any admistratvie changes .
| Total Households | 46 |
| Total Population | 165 |
| Male Population | 93 |
| Female Population | 72 |
| SC Population | 6 |
| ST Population | 0 |
| Total Literates | 96 |
| Literacy Rate | 58.18% |
Ramarajupalli village has a total of 46 households with a total population of 165. The village consists of 93 males and 72 females.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population is 6 and the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population is 0. The village has 96 literates according to Census 2011 data. The gender ratio of Ramarajupalli village is 774 females per 1000 males.
